Cost of Foundation Pier Replacement in Sterling
The cost of foundation pier replacement in Sterling, VA, can vary widely based on several factors. Foundation piers are crucial for maintaining the structural integrity of your home, and replacing them is a significant investment. Understanding the factors that influence the cost and the common tasks involved can help homeowners budget effectively for this essential repair.
Factors Influencing Costs
- Type of Foundation: Different foundations require different types of piers, affecting the overall cost.
 - Soil Conditions: Poor soil conditions may necessitate additional work, increasing expenses.
 - Depth of Piers: Deeper piers require more labor and materials, raising the cost.
 - Number of Piers Needed: More piers mean higher costs due to increased materials and labor.
 -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as can complicate installation, leading to higher costs.
 -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
 - Material Quality: Higher quality materials, while more durable, will also be more expensive.
 - Contractor Rates: Labor costs can vary based on the contractor's experience and demand in Sterling, VA.
 
Average Costs for Common Tasks
| Task | Average Cost (Sterling, VA) | 
|---|---|
| Initial Inspection | $200 - $400 | 
| Soil Testing | $300 - $700 | 
| Permit Fees | $50 - $200 | 
| Pier Installation (per pier) | $1,000 - $3,000 | 
| Excavation | $500 - $2,000 | 
| Material Costs (per pier) | $200 - $800 | 
| Total Replacement Cost | $5,000 - $20,000 |
